Ingredients:

• 250 gms – Paneer/Cottage Cheese, cut into 1/2 inch cubes
• 2 – Bell peppers, cubed
• 4 sticks – Spring onions, chopped
• 2 – Green chillies, sliced
• 1 tsp – Peppercorns / Pepper powder
• 1 tsp – Ginger, finely chopped
• 4 – Garlic cloves, chopped
• 1 tsp – Corn starch/ Corn flour
• 3 tsp – Oil
• 1 – Tomato, diced
• 1 – Onion, sliced
• Salt as per taste
• Tomato sauce
• Soy sauce

Method:

  1. Add a pinch of salt to the corn flour and toss the paneer cubes in it.
  2. Heat 2 tsp of oil in a pan, fry the paneer until it is golden brown on all sides. Transfer to another bowl.
  3. In the same pan add 1 more tsp of oil and fry the chillies and onion.
  4. Add garlic and ginger, fry until soft.
  5. Add bell peppers, fry for 1 minute, and add tomatoes and salt.
  6. Fry for another minute and finally add the paneer cubes.
  7. Add all the sauces and saute for some more time.
  8. Make a solution with 1 tsp corn flour and 90ml water.
  9. Add this to the paneer and let it thicken. Turn off the heat.
  10. Finally add freshly crushed peppercorns or pepper powder.
  11. Garnish with the spring onions.
  12. Serve hot with steamed rice.
